Sanskrit name Keerat literally means horseman or groom. Keerat also means procuress.
Mention of Sanskrit Name Keerat is found in Tandya-Brahman (ताण्ड्य-ब्राह्मण), Manu-Smiriti (मनु-स्मृति) and Mahabharata (महाभारत) where Keerat is name of a mountain tribe.
Reference of this name is also found in Varah-Mihir-Brihat-Sanhita (वराह-मिहिर-बृहत्-संहिता) in which Keerat is the name of a prince of state Kiraat.
Keerat is also mentioned in writings of lexicographers like Hemchandra and Halayudh with meanings like groom, horseman, dwarf or plant.
Keerat also founds to be referred in Sir Monier-Williams dictionary with similar meanings like above.
